In Havana, Cuba, a massive power outage occurred, affecting millions across the country due to an outage at the Diezmero substation. The Ministry of Energy and Mines is working on the recovery process as provinces like Guantánamo and Santiago de Cuba experienced blackouts. Cuba’s power grid struggles with frequent outages due to fuel shortages and aging infrastructure, prompting the installation of photovoltaic parks to address the issue.

Toronto's 2005 Boxing Day gunman faces 1st-degree murder charge in Montreal
Jeremiah Valentine is charged with first-degree murder for the death of Abdeck Kenedith Ibrahim in Montreal. He was previously convicted in a 2005 Toronto shootout linked to rival gangs that resulted in the death of 15-year-old Jane Creba.
